Dry Falls is along U.S. Highway 64 along the Callasaja river located in the Nantahala National Forest. One of the most visited falls, Dry Falls, is the 75-ft tall waterfall that flows over a cliff allowing visitors to walk up under the falls. Be prepared to get wet when the water flow is high!
Also, be care under the falls as the rocks are slippery and you can slip and fall.
During winter the falls might be closed due to possible snow and ice or the gate may be closed going under the falls. They do have a viewing platform year round.
